概括
许多眼科期刊现在有人工智能 (AI) 政策用于手稿写作,但超过三分之一的期刊仍然缺乏它们. 这凸显了随着技术的进步,需要制定一致的AI指南.

主要方法:
- 一项横截面研究审查了84个PubMed索引眼科期刊的指导方针.
- 评估了人工智能政策对手稿生成的普遍性.
- 期刊指标 (CiteScore,JIF,JCI,SNIP,SJR) 和特征 (MEDLINE索引,社会归属) 在具有和没有AI政策的期刊之间进行了比较.
主要成果:
- 84个期刊中有63.1%的期刊有AI政策,在研究期间没有显著变化.
- 与非MEDLINE期刊 (0%) 相比,MEDLINE索引期刊更有可能有AI政策 (68.8%).
- 具有人工智能政策的期刊显示了显著更高的文献指标 (CiteScore,SNIP,SJR,JIF,JCI).
结论:
- 大多数眼科期刊已经在手稿写作方面实施了人工智能政策.
- 在超过三分之一的期刊中没有人工智能指导方针,这表明需要标准化.
- 鉴于人工智能技术的快速发展,一致和全面的AI政策至关重要.

The Retina
The retina is a layer of nervous tissue at the back of the eye that transduces light into neural signals. This process, called phototransduction, is carried out by rod and cone photoreceptor cells in the back of the retina.
Vision
Vision is the result of light being detected and transduced into neural signals by the retina of the eye. This information is then further analyzed and interpreted by the brain. First, light enters the front of the eye and is focused by the cornea and lens onto the retina—a thin sheet of neural tissue lining the back of the eye. Because of refraction through the convex lens of the eye, images are projected onto the retina upside-down and reversed.
Open Angle Glaucoma: Treatment
In open-angle glaucoma, the iridocorneal angle remains open, but the trabecular meshwork becomes stiff, slowing down the outflow of aqueous humor. This causes a buildup of aqueous humor in the anterior chamber, leading to a sudden increase in intraocular pressure. The treatment for open-angle glaucoma focuses on reducing the elevated intraocular pressure by either decreasing the secretion of aqueous humor or increasing its outflow.

Angle Closure Glaucoma: Treatment
Angle-closure glaucoma, or closed-angle glaucoma, is an eye condition where the iris bulges out and blocks the iridocorneal angle, resulting in a buildup of aqueous humor and increased intraocular pressure. Immediate medical attention is necessary due to the sudden onset of symptoms. The treatment for angle-closure glaucoma includes short-term and long-term approaches.
